This is how RTX 5090 and RTX 5070 Ti compete in popular games:

  • RTX 5090 is 52% faster in 1080p
  • RTX 5090 is 66% faster in 1440p
  • RTX 5090 is 83% faster in 4K

Here's the range of performance differences observed across popular games:

  • in The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t, with 4K resolution and the High Preset, the RTX 5090 is 111% faster.
  • in Metro Exodus, with 1080p resolution and the High Preset, the RTX 5070 Ti is 188% faster.

All in all, in popular games:

  • RTX 5090 is ahead in 41 test (68%)
  • RTX 5070 Ti is ahead in 2 tests (3%)
  • there's a draw in 17 tests (28%)

Pros & cons summary


Performance score 86.82 71.24
Maximum RAM amount 32 GB 16 GB
Power consumption (TDP) 575 Watt 300 Watt

RTX 5090 has a 21.9% higher aggregate performance score, and a 100% higher maximum VRAM amount.

RTX 5070 Ti, on the other hand, has 91.7% lower power consumption.

The GeForce RTX 5090 is our recommended choice as it beats the GeForce RTX 5070 Ti in performance tests.
